Donald Trump warned of a possible 200% tax on drug imports within a two-year window. The statement is important for UPSC because it signals a protectionist trade stance that can affect pharmaceutical supply chains, import dependence, and market access for exporters.

What happened

Donald Trump warned of a steep tax on drug imports. No detailed policy design, implementation timeline, exempt categories, or legal framework is provided in the supplied material.

Why it matters for UPSC

A tariff on pharmaceutical imports sits at the intersection of international trade, industrial policy, and public health. Such a move can influence drug prices, sourcing decisions, and the strategic push for domestic manufacturing capacity.
